Работа с большими объемами данных в Microsoft Excel часто превращается в бесконечный спуск вглубь файла, когда заголовки столбцов теряются где-то далеко вверху экрана. Каждый пользователь, сталкивавшийся с таблицами, насчитывающими десятки тысяч строк, знает это неприятное чувство дезориентации. В такие моменты вопрос о том, как в Excel попасть в начало таблицы, становится критически важным для продолжения продуктивной работы.
Существует несколько способов выполнить этот маневр, и выбор конкретного метода зависит от ваших текущих задач и структуры документа. Можно использовать горячие клавиши, которые являются стандартом индустрии, или же полагаться на встроенные инструменты навигации интерфейса. Понимание этих механизмов позволяет экономить драгоценное время и избегать ошибок, связанных с вводом данных не в ту ячейку.
В этой статье мы детально разберем все доступные опции перемещения, включая скрытые функции и особенности работы с замороженными областями. Вы узнаете, почему стандартная прокрутка колесиком мыши — это худший вариант для больших массивов, и как использовать диалоговое окно перехода для мгновенного перемещения. Освоив эти приемы, вы сможете уверенно управлять даже самыми громоздкими отчетами.
Использование горячих клавиш для мгновенного перехода
Самый быстрый и эффективный способ вернуться к ячейке A1 или первому заполненному участку — это использование комбинации клавиш. В операционной системе Windows стандартом де-факто является сочетание Ctrl + Home. При однократном нажатии курсор мгновенно перемещается в левый верхний угол рабочего листа. Это действие не зависит от того, где вы находитесь: даже если вы прокрутили экран на миллионную строку, система выполнит команду мгновенно.
Для пользователей macOS логика остается схожей, но изменяется модификатор: необходимо нажать Command + Home или, на некоторых клавиатурах, Fn + Control + Стрелка влево. Важно отметить, что поведение этой команды может слегка меняться в зависимости от того, выделен ли у вас какой-либо диапазон ячеек или курсор стоит одиночно. Если выделена область, горячие клавиши могут переместить активную ячейку выделения в начало, но не обязательно сдвинут видимую область экрана, если она не была зафиксирована.
Существует также нюанс, связанный с режимом редактирования. Если вы начали печатать текст внутри ячейки (мигает курсор ввода), комбинация Ctrl + Home переместит курсор в начало текста внутри этой конкретной ячейки, а не в начало таблицы. Чтобы выйти из режима редактирования и активировать навигацию по листу, нужно сначала нажать Enter или Esc.
Ниже приведена таблица, демонстрирующая различия в навигационных командах для разных операционных систем и сценариев использования:
| Действие | Windows | macOS | Результат |
|---|---|---|---|
| Переход в начало листа | Ctrl + Home |
Cmd + Home |
Курсор в A1 |
| Переход в начало строки | Home |
Fn + Стрелка влево |
Курсор в столбце A |
| Переход в начало текста | Ctrl + Home (в режиме правки) |
Cmd + Стрелка влево |
Начало строки внутри ячейки |
| Переход на предыдущий лист | Ctrl + Page Up |
Option + Page Up |
Смена вкладки файла |
Навигация через диалоговое окно "Перейти"
Если клавиатурные сокращения по какой-то причине недоступны или вы предпочитаете визуальный интерфейс, отличным инструментом станет функция "Перейти" (Go To). Вызвать это окно можно, нажав клавишу F5 или комбинацию Ctrl + G. Это универсальный инструмент, который позволяет не только возвращаться в начало, но и переходить к любым именованным диапазонам или последним использованным ячейкам.
В открывшемся окне в поле "Ссылка" по умолчанию может отображаться адрес текущей ячейки. Чтобы гарантированно попасть в начало таблицы, введите в это поле A1 и нажмите OK или Enter. Этот метод особенно полезен, когда вы работаете с файлом, где стандартная ячейка A1 занята какими-либо техническими данными или логотипом, и вам нужно перейти именно к началу рабочей области, которую вы определяете сами.
⚠️ Внимание: Если вы используете функцию "Перейти" для перехода к именованному диапазону, убедитесь, что имя диапазона введено точно, с учетом регистра, хотя Excel обычно не чувствителен к регистру в адресах ячеек.
Окно "Перейти" также хранит историю последних четырех использованных адресов, что позволяет быстро переключаться между ключевыми точками документа без необходимости каждый раз вводить координаты вручную. Это делает навигацию более гибкой по сравнению с простым возвратом в точку A1.
Работа с большими массивами данных и закрепление областей
Когда таблица содержит тысячи строк, постоянный возврат в начало для проверки заголовков может быть утомительным. В таких случаях целесообразнее использовать функцию "Закрепить области". Она позволяет зафиксировать верхнюю строку (или несколько первых строк) так, чтобы они оставались видимыми при прокрутке вниз. Для этого перейдите на вкладку Вид и выберите Закрепить области -> Закрепить верхнюю строку.
Использование закрепления меняет подход к навигации: вам больше не нужно постоянно думать, как в Excel попасть в начало таблицы, чтобы увидеть названия столбцов, так как они всегда находятся перед глазами. Однако, если вам все же необходимо вернуться к первой строке данных для ее редактирования, сочетание Ctrl + Home по-прежнему остается самым быстрым решением, даже при закрепленных панелях.
Стоит учитывать, что при работе с очень тяжелыми файлами, содержащими сложные формулы или внешние связи, процесс перерисовки экрана при резком скачке в начало может занять долю секунды. В этот момент интерфейс может временно откликаться медленнее. Это нормальное поведение программы при обработке больших объемов памяти.
☑️ Оптимизация работы с большими таблицами
Переход к началу заполненной области
Часто под "началом таблицы" пользователи понимают не абсолютную ячейку A1, а первую ячейку с данными, особенно если над ней расположены пустые строки или служебные заголовки отчетов. Стандартное сочетание клавиш Ctrl + Home всегда ведет в A1, игнорируя наличие данных. Для навигации по границам заполненных областей используется другая логика.
Чтобы перейти к началу текущего непрерывного блока данных, можно использовать клавишу Home в сочетании со стрелками, но более эффективен метод двойного клика по границе ячейки. Однако, самый надежный способ найти верхнюю границу данных — это использование сочетания Ctrl + Стрелка вверх. Если вы находитесь в середине таблицы, это действие подбросит вас к первому заполненному ряду текущего столбца.
Если же вам нужно найти самую первую заполненную ячейку во всем листе (независимо от столбца), можно воспользоваться поиском. Нажмите Ctrl + F, введите символ звездочки * (который означает любой символ) и нажмите Найти все. В списке результатов первой будет указана ячейка с минимальными координатами, содержащая данные. Клик по ней переместит вас к началу информационной части таблицы.
⚠️ Внимание: Использование символа подстановки
*в поиске найдет любую ячейку с текстом или числом. Если в ячейке A1 стоит пробел, поиск может проигнорировать его как пустоту, если не настроен соответствующим образом, поэтому визуальная проверка все же необходима.
Особенности навигации в Excel для веб-браузеров
Работа в Excel Online (веб-версия) имеет свои особенности, так как она зависит от возможностей браузера и операционной системы. В большинстве современных браузеров (Chrome, Edge, Firefox) сочетание Ctrl + Home работает аналогично десктопной версии, возвращая пользователя в ячейку A1. Однако, если браузер перехватывает эту команду для своих нужд (например, прокрутки самой страницы браузера вверх), результат может быть неожиданным.
В таких случаях рекомендуется использовать интерфейс программы. В веб-версии часто доступна кнопка быстрой прокрутки или возможность клика по заголовку столбца "A" и строки "1" одновременно, хотя это менее эффективно. Также стоит проверить, не включен ли режим совместимости браузера, который может ограничивать функционал горячих клавиш.
Для пользователей iPad или планшетов навигация осуществляется через экранные жесты или подключение внешней клавиатуры. При использовании внешней клавиатуры для iPad с поддержкой сочетаний клавиш, Cmd + Fn + Стрелка влево часто эмулирует действие Home, позволяя быстро возвращаться к началу документа.
Почему Ctrl+Home не работает в моем браузере?
Некоторые расширения браузера (например, менеджеры паролей или блокировщики рекламы) могут перехватывать глобальные сочетания клавиш. Попробуйте открыть Excel в режиме инкогнито или отключить расширения для проверки.
Частые ошибки при навигации и их решение
Одной из распространенных проблем является ситуация, когда пользователь нажимает Ctrl + Home, но курсор перемещается не в A1, а в какую-то другую ячейку, например, C5. Это происходит, если в файле ранее применялось форматирование, комментарии или данные в ячейках между A1 и C5, даже если сейчас они кажутся пустыми. Excel считает последнюю использованную ячейку границей листа.
Чтобы исправить это и заставить Excel считать началом именно A1, необходимо очистить весь лист от лишнего "мусора". Выделите все строки ниже последней нужной и столбцы правее последнего нужного, затем удалите их полностью (правый клик -> Удалить, а не Очистить содержимое). После этого сохраните файл (Ctrl + S). При следующем открытии файла граница листа сбросится.
Также пользователи часто путают переход в начало строки (Home) и начало листа (Ctrl + Home). Если вы забыли нажать Ctrl, вы окажетесь в столбце A, но на той же строке, где были. Визуально это может быть не сразу заметно, если таблица широкая и горизонтальная прокрутка не сброшена.
Что делать, если клавиша Home на клавиатуре не работает?
Если физическая клавиша Home неисправна или отсутствует (как на некоторых ноутбуках), используйте экранную клавиатуру Windows (Win + U) или переназначьте клавиши через сторонние утилы. Также можно использовать вкладку "Главная" -> "Найти и выделить" -> "Перейти" и ввести A1.
Как перейти в начало таблицы, если она является частью "Умной таблицы" (Ctrl+T)?
Находясь внутри "Умной таблицы", сочетание Ctrl + Home все равно приведет вас в ячейку A1 всего листа. Чтобы перейти к заголовку самой таблицы, используйте Ctrl + Стрелка вверх, находясь в любом столбце таблицы, или выделите любую ячейку таблицы и нажмите Ctrl + Home внутри режима редактирования, если нужно начало строки.
Можно ли создать кнопку на листе для перехода в начало?
Да, это возможно через макрос VBA. Код Range("A1").Select, назначенный на кнопку формы или фигуру, позволит выполнять переход одним кликом мыши, что удобно для презентаций или отчетов для других пользователей.
Влияет ли масштабирование (Zoom) на работу навигации?
Нет, уровень масштаба (например, 50% или 200%) не влияет на логическое перемещение курсора. Команда перехода в начало таблицы всегда приведет вас к ячейке A1, независимо от того, сколько ячеек видно на экране в данный момент.